The Document ID log report view may stop responding when you view a Document ID log report that contains lots of groups in SharePoint Server 2007

Expand all | Collapse all

SYMPTOMS

In Microsoft Office SharePoint Server 2007, when you view a Document ID log report that contains lots of groups, the Document ID log report view may stop responding.

CAUSE

This behavior occurs if an international language pack, such as the East Asian language pack, is installed on the SharePoint Server 2007 server. In this case, you may experience a delay before the Document ID log report view is displayed. This occurs if the Document ID log report contains more than 4000 groups.

WORKAROUND

To work around this issue, create a new view. To do this, follow these steps:
  1. On the SharePoint Server 2007 home page, click Lists.
  2. On the All Site Content page, click Document ID Log Report.
  3. On the Document ID Log Report page, click the list next to View, and then click Create View.
  4. On the Create View: Document ID Log Report page, click Standard View.
  5. Type a name for the new view, select the options that you want, and then click OK.
